Condividi tramite


Metodo IVsExtensionRepositoryQuery<T>.ExecuteAsync (Object)

In modo asincrono esegue una query di IVsExtensionRepositoryQuery<T> .

Spazio dei nomi:  Microsoft.VisualStudio.ExtensionManager
Assembly:  Microsoft.VisualStudio.ExtensionManager (in Microsoft.VisualStudio.ExtensionManager.dll)

Sintassi

'Dichiarazione
Sub ExecuteAsync ( _
    state As Object _
)
void ExecuteAsync(
    Object state
)
void ExecuteAsync(
    Object^ state
)
abstract ExecuteAsync : 
        state:Object -> unit
function ExecuteAsync(
    state : Object
)

Parametri

  • state
    Tipo: Object

    Un oggetto contenente le informazioni sullo stato dell' utente.

Note

Sebbene questa API supporta l'infrastruttura di Gestione estensioni , è consigliabile non utilizzarla in quanto è soggetto a modifiche.

Utilizzare questo metodo per ottenere informazioni sulle estensioni fornite dal servizio di repository di estensione. Per ulteriori informazioni, vedere IVsExtensionRepositoryQuery<T>.

Il parametro di state può contenere informazioni quali la pagina corrente sia visualizzato nell' elenco dell' estensione dell' utente. il parametro di state deve essere univoco.

Sicurezza di .NET Framework

Vedere anche

Riferimenti

IVsExtensionRepositoryQuery<T> Interfaccia

Overload ExecuteAsync

Spazio dei nomi Microsoft.VisualStudio.ExtensionManager